Actress Lisa Kudrow has reportedly joined the cast of political drama TV series "Scandal".
Kudrow shot to fame after playing the role of Phoebe Buffay in popular sitcom "Friends". In "Scandal", she steps into the role of a politician, reports contactmusic.com.
She will share screen space with actress Kerry Washington.
"Scandal" is said to be Kudrow's biggest television commitment ever since "Friends", a 10-year-long franchise, came to an end in 2004.
The third series of "Scandal" will go on air Oct 3.
In the forthcoming season, the show focusses on Pope's crisis management firm and its involvement in White House government affairs.
